•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Temizle Butonu

Katılım
18 Mart 2022
Mesajlar
34
Excel Vers. ve Dili
2019 TÜRKÇE
Kod:
Sub formtemizle()
Dim slc
For Each slc In Me.Controls
If TypeOf slc Is MSForms.TextBox Or TypeOf slc Is MSForms.ComboBox Then
slc.Text = ""
End If
Next
End Sub



slc.Text = "" ---> satırında hata veriyor.

Yardımcı olabilir misiniz. Teşekkürler
 
Hata verecek bir durum görünmüyor.

Hata veren dosyanızı paylaşırsanız inceleyip bilgi verebiliriz.
 
sorun çözüldü teşekkürler.

(Butonu kaldırıp yeniden ekledim. kodda sorun yokmuş.)
 
sorun çözüldü teşekkürler.

(Butonu kaldırıp yeniden ekledim. kodda sorun yokmuş.)


sorun tekrar oluştu
asıl problem şundan kaynaklanıyor

hatanın nedeni şu : form üzerinden combobax ın style özelliğini fmstyleDropDownCombo dan DropDownList yapınca bu hata oluşuyor.



ama ben combobaxa müdahale edilsin istemiyorum.
 
Böyle deneyiniz.

C++:
Sub formtemizle()
Dim slc
For Each slc In Me.Controls
If TypeOf slc Is MSForms.TextBox Or TypeOf slc Is MSForms.ComboBox Then
slc.Value = ""
End If
Next
End Sub
 
Böyle deneyiniz.

C++:
Sub formtemizle()
Dim slc
For Each slc In Me.Controls
If TypeOf slc Is MSForms.TextBox Or TypeOf slc Is MSForms.ComboBox Then
slc.Value = ""
End If
Next
End Sub


Üstad Allah razı olsun çok teşekkürler kesin çözüldü sorun yardımınızla.
 
Geri
Üst